This New Edition Lifts The Book To Breathtaking Realms. The Extraordinary Images, Produced With The Latest Microphotography Technologies, Are Displayed On More Reader-Friendly Larger Page Layouts. Most Of The 205 Full-Color Photographs Were Taken Using Scanning Electron Microscopy (Sem), Which Allows Us To See Our World As Never Before.Each Page Features A Single Image, A Remarkable Close-Up That Reveals Form, Shape And Color In Incredible Detail. The Book Is Divided Into Six Chapters That Cover: Microorganismsbotanythe Human Bodyzoologymineralstechnologyevery Photograph Is Accompanied By An Informative Caption That Describes The Image, How It Was Captured And The Number Of Magnifications.With The Stunning Production Values Of Its Full-Color Photographs And Its Clearly Written Text, Microcosmos Provides A Fascinating Journey Of Discovery For Every Reader.
